If I Had a Hammer

Just about everyone - even those renting a furnished property or living in a newly-built home - can feel the need for a change in environment, or a simply an urge to freshen the place up. While many home improvements can by done DIY, other jobs may need architect plans, buildings approval and the help of a contractor.
